Coverage for Storm Damage
Hurricane damage protection is a common part of dwelling insurance in Central Florida, but with important limitations. Most policies cover roof damage from wind, broken windows, and siding loss—but may exclude homes with older roofs or non-impact-resistant materials. The windstorm deductible often kicks in during declared events, requiring you to pay 2%–5% of your dwelling value out of pocket. Understanding Coverage Payouts
Choosing between replacement cost value and actual cash value is a critical decision when buying dwelling coverage. RCV pays to rebuild your home at today’s prices, minus your deductible, while ACV subtracts depreciation—leaving you with less money for repairs. Most experts recommend RCV, especially in Orlando where construction costs are rising. A independent insurance agency can provide an accurate replacement cost analysis to help you decide based on your budget and risk level.

Determining Adequate Coverage Amount
Setting the right coverage amount is non-negotiable—too little leaves you underinsured, too much wastes money. Your dwelling limit should reflect the construction cost of your home, not market value. Factors like square footage, materials, roof type, and local labor rates matter. A home inspection for coverage from a licensed insurance agent helps avoid gaps. Can Flood Damage Part of Dwelling Coverage in Orlando FL?
No, standard home structure insurance does leave unprotected flood damage caused by hurricanes, heavy rains, or overflowing bodies of water—common risks in coastal-adjacent zones. For that, you need a separate NFIP policy, which can be obtained through a Orlando FL insurance professional.
The standard water coverage offers up to $250,000 in building coverage, but some homeowners opt for private flood policies for greater security. Given Orlando’s susceptibility to flash flooding and storm surges, adding this layer is a smart move for affordable home insurance planning.
